Products
GG网络技术分享 2025-04-05 09:11 9
Cocos2d-x,作为一款强大的开源游戏开发框架,支持多种操作系统,其中Linux版因其跨平台性和高性能而被众多开发者青睐。
对于需要编译特定版本库的开发者,可以使用make -j8
或make -j8 BUILD_MODE=release
命令进行编译。其中,-j8
表示使用8个线程并行编译,可根据CPU核心数调整。
export COCOS2D_X_ROOT=/home/username/cocos2d-x
export PATH=$PATH:$COCOS2D_X_ROOT/tools/cocos2d-console:$COCOS2D_X_ROOT/tools/cocos2d-console/bin
执行source ~/.bashrc
使更改生效。
Cocos2d-x在不同平台的入口不同。在win32平台,程序从_tWinMain开始。在每一个Cocos2d-x程序中的main.cpp中都能找到。随后,程序就完全交给了Cocos2d-x引擎去处理。
《Cocos2d-x之Lua核心编程》是由触控教育部门策划出版的图书,众多业界大牛不吝赞誉。全书基于Cocos2d-Lua v3.3 Final版本撰写,适用于Cocos2d-Lua v3.x所有版本。
在编译Cocos2d-x引擎时出现错误,提示缺少依赖库,可能是由于系统中没有安装该依赖库或版本不符合要求。根据错误信息,确定缺失的依赖库及其版本要求,然后使用包管理器进行安装或更新。例如,提示缺少libglfw-dev
,可以运行sudo apt-get install libglfw-dev
进行安装。
Cocos2d-x的核心概念是场景和节点。Cocos2d-x是一款跨平台的游戏开发框架,具备高效性能和易用性,广泛应用于手机游戏和电子游戏领域。
设置项目目录后,运行上述命令,Cocos2d-x工具会在当前目录下创建一个名为"MyGame"的项目文件夹,并生成相应的项目结构和文件。
配置环境变量,将Cocos2d-x的安装路径添加到系统的环境变量中,以便在终端中方便地访问Cocos2d-x的命令和工具。
通过本文的介绍,相信大家对Cocos2d-x Linux版有了更深入的了解。随着技术的不断发展和更新,Cocos2d-x也将不断完善其在Linux系统上的支持。未来,相信会有更多开发者选择Cocos2d-x在Linux系统上进行游戏开发,为游戏行业带来更多可能性。欢迎用实际体验验证我们的观点。
Demand feedback